      How to Create a New WordPress User

      Need some help designing your site, but don't want to give away your login information?  You can create multiple users right from your WordPress Dashboard!  Here is how:


      1. Login to your site's How to Login to Your WordPress Dashboard.

      2. Locate the Users option on the left hand toolbar, and select the Add New option from the submenu.

      image-20240730-210819.png
      1. The Add New User form will then appear for you to fill out and complete:

        • A. Enter the username you wish to use for the new user.  It is encouraged to not use something generic like 'admin' as the username for security purposes.

        • B. Enter the email address this information will be sent to.

        • C. Enter the first name of the user.  This field is optional.

        • D. Enter the last name of the user.  This field is optional.

        • E. Enter the name of the website.  This field is optional.

        • F. Create a Login Password.  There is no strength requirement, but a strong password is always encouraged.

        • G. Check the  box to send the password information to the new user's email address.

        • H. Select the dropdown menu to view which role you with to assign the user.  Each role has slightly permissions.  The most common are Administrator, Editor, and Author.  Below is a breakdown of some permissions:

      • 1 - Administrator: User has access to all of the admin features within your WordPress site.

      • 2 - Editor: User can publish and manage any posts on your site.  Both posts they've created, and posts other have created.

      • 3 - Author: User is able to create and manage their own posts, and ONLY their own posts.

      • 4 - Contributor: User can write up and edit their own posts, and save them as drafts.  They cannot publish any content online though.

      • 5 - Subscriber: User can only manage their own individual profile, and has read only access to the contents of the site.

      1. Once you have completed the form, select the Add New User button to save the changes.   You will then be taken to the main Users page where you will be able to view, and edit your account users in the future.
